How they compare
Philippines currently reports 2.10 million against 1.70 million in Thailand, a difference of 399,730.
That makes Philippines's figure about 1.2 times Thailand's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 23 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Thailand ahead.
Philippines ranks 12th and Thailand ranks 15th of 188 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Philippines averaged higher in 1 and Thailand in 2.

About this data
Imputed observations are not based on national data, are subject to high uncertainty and should not be used for country comparisons or rankings.This series is based on the 13th ICLS definitions. This indicator refers to total weekly hours actually worked of employed persons in their main job. For more information, refer to the ILO Modelled Estimates (ILOEST) database description.
